Output 659043b60e8714e832e2115eebb513f101b62ea550c4987d383a3135e10cf34d:0

value
249732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2ad77ca8be87c2c5d90e05eec04deefff4b9860 OP_EQUAL
address
3GXBCPCtSUDUnXjAH36Kdw7Vqm5h2owxDJ
transaction
659043b60e8714e832e2115eebb513f101b62ea550c4987d383a3135e10cf34d
confirmations
181075
spent
true